How much clearence should you have. I have a disc./ drum set up and a very low pedal. I've bled them and adjusted the rears and it's still low. My pedal push rod is pretty tight, in fact I had to pry it a little to get the bolt through. The rod is adjusted all the way in, so do I need to shorten the rod a 1/4 inch or so. Shouldn't need a lot of clearance-maybe 1/16" to 1/8". If you had to pry on it to get the through bolt in, your pre-loading the master cylinder piston and that's not good. Shorten it 1/4", as you suggested, and then use the adjusting clevis to get the clearance correct.
